Register of Charities - The Charity Commission THE NEUROSCIENCE SUPPORT GROUP AT THE QUEENS MEDICAL CENTRE
Activities - how the charity spends its money
Main aims: Raising money for research into neurodegenerative diseases (e.g. Alzheimers, Parkinsons, MS and MND) at the University of Nottingham Medical School and the Queen's Medical Centre. In particular we provide small grants for PhD projects, urgent equipment replacement and awareness promotion. Legacies, gift aided and other donations, garden day and coffee morning proceeds welcome
